St Helier (London) train station is a quaint, suburban station situated on the cusp of Central London, in the London Borough of Sutton. Ideal for those looking to escape the rush of the city, while still having access to its many wonders, St Helier provides a perfect midpoint for your travel needs.
While St Helier station prides itself on having a working blend of modern services in a community-friendly environment, it offers basic yet essential amenities. It does not contain a formal ticket office, yet you can easily purchase or collect your tickets via the automated machines available. These machines are accessible and cater to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, keeping accessibility at the forefront.
St Helier might not boast luxurious amenities; there are no toilets, baby changing facilities, waiting rooms, or refreshment stands. However, seating is available should you need to rest before your journey. For those on two wheels, the station caters with 30 bicycle storage spaces that are secure and CCTV-monitored. Despite its modest offerings, the presence of its accessible ticket machines and induction loops makes it a commendable choice for efficient travel.
Having comprehensive access to onward travel is a hallmark of St Helier station. While the station itself lacks taxi services, it is well-connected with the local bus network. Detailed onward journey information can be accessed through the Onward Travel Information Map, ensuring that your adventure beyond the train station is as seamless as your rail journey.
The station also accommodates rail replacement services when necessary, which could be a lifesaver during unexpected disruptions on the line.

Micheldever train station is nestled in the heart of the Hampshire countryside, offering a quaint and serene departure point for travelers. Whether you're looking to escape to bustling cities or explore nearby charming villages, Micheldever station connects you seamlessly to various destinations. While the station itself is relatively small, it plays an important role in linking rural Hampshire to the broader UK rail network.
The station is equipped with a ticket office, though its opening hours are limited to weekdays from 06:20 to 09:05. For convenience, ticket machines are available all the time, where you can also collect tickets bought online. Accessible ticket machines cater to travelers with a Disabled Persons Railcard, ensuring an inclusive travel experience.
While Micheldever station may not boast a wide range of amenities, it offers the essentials such as bicycle storage with racks and lockers, and pay phones available for use. Unfortunately, there are no refreshment facilities, shops, or ATMs, so prepare ahead and plan accordingly.
Accessibility is a key consideration at Micheldever station, with an induction loop facility, an accessible ticket machine, and a ramp for train access. However, it's important to note that the station has a step-free category C designation, meaning it does not offer complete step-free access. For travelers requiring assistance, the guard on board the train provides assistance for boarding and alighting trains, and you can book assistance up to two hours before your journey.
Despite its rural location, Micheldever station provides connections to various onward travel options. Local buses can be coordinated through information available in printable format, which can be accessed here. Additionally, there is a designated area in the station forecourt for rail replacement services.
